同学你好,很高兴为您解答,AP计算机科学有两门,包括AP计算机科学A和AP计算机科学原理,这两门是独立的两门课程,虾下面分别介绍一下这两个考试的内容。
一、ap计算机科学a
AP计算机科学A是大学水平的计算机科学入门课程。主要考察学生在探索模块化、变量和控制结构等概念的理解,以及通过分析、编写和测试代码来考察他们对编码的理解。
ap计算机科学a考试分为两部分:
第一部分:选择题
第一部分有40道选择题,占考试分数的50%,本部分需要1小时30分钟。
第二部分:问答题
第二部分有4道问答题,占考试分数的50%,本部分需要1小时30分钟。
问题1:方法和控制结构—学生将被要求编写程序代码来创建类的对象和调用方法,并使用表达式、条件语句和迭代语句来满足方法规范。
问题2:类—学生将被要求编写程序代码,通过创建类来定义新的类型,并使用表达式、条件语句和迭代语句来满足方法规范。
问题3:数组/数组列表—将要求学生使用表达式、条件语句和迭代语句编写满足方法规范的程序代码,并创建、遍历和操作1D数组或数组列表对象中的元素。
问题4:2D数组—学生将被要求使用表达式、条件语句和迭代语句编写满足方法规范的程序代码,并创建、遍历和操作2D数组对象中的元素。
二、ap计算机科学原理
AP计算机科学原理是一门大学水平的计算机入门课程,向学生介绍计算机科学领域的广度。学生学习设计和评估解决方案,并通过开发算法和程序应用计算机科学来解决问题。他们将抽象纳入程序,并使用数据发现新知识。学生还将解释计算创新和计算系统(包括互联网)是如何工作的,探索它们的潜在影响,并为协作和道德的计算文化做出贡献。
ap计算机科学原理考试分为两部分:
第一部分:选择题考试
第一部分有70道选择题,包括57单项选择题和8个多选题,以及关于计算创新的5篇精选阅读文章,本部分占考试分数的70%,本部分需要2小时。
第二部分:创建绩效任务
第二部分要求学生开发自己选择的计算机程序,学生需要至少12小时的课堂时间才能完成,本部分占整个分数的30%。
以上就是有关ap计算机科学考试内容的总结,大家都清楚了吗?还有不懂的地方,欢迎随时在线咨询我们的老师哦~